<title>Bikesure's tips on cutting the cost of bike insurance</title>
<description>&lt;p&gt;&lt;img src=&quot;&lt;%PATH_IMAGE%&gt;news/posts/271-1.jpg&quot; align=&quot;right&quot; class=&quot;news&quot; /&gt;Times are tough. Bikers, along with everyone else, are looking for ways they can make savings. And that even includes the essentials, such as insurance. But how can you reduce the cost without reducing the cover?&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.bikesure.co.uk/&quot; target=&quot;_blank&quot;&gt;Bikesure&lt;/a&gt; has just released some money-saving tips for lowering motorcycle insurance costs. The company, one of the UK's biggest specialist bike insurance brokers, says that it still finds occasions where bikers are forgetting to tell them about potential money-saving factors that could slash premiums.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Get a qualification&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;br&gt;
The biggest saving bikers can make on their insurance is by proving that they have real riding skills and experience, with a qualification such as the &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.ridedrive.co.uk/&quot; target=&quot;_blank&quot;&gt;Ride Drive&lt;/a&gt; scheme. In many cases Bikesure can give an immediate discount of as much as 25%, and for younger bike riders the total saving in the first year alone can often cover the cost of a Ride Drive course.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Not only does a discount continue year after year (provided there's no claim), but it can also be applied to the biker's car insurance.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Join an owners club&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;br&gt;
Join a club and this could provide an immediate saving. For example, Bikesure gives up to 15% discount to bikers who are current members of a recognised motorcycle or riders club.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;And the discount doesn't stop at bikes. Club members can get further discounts on other insurance, such as car, motorhome or home insurance.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Going far?&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;br&gt;
Bikers can get another immediate discount with a Limited Mileage policy, and the lower the mileage, the bigger the savings. However, keep a watch on the milometer - the broker needs to know if the bike is likely to exceed the agreed mileage limit.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Multi bike?&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;br&gt;
Bikers with two or more bikes can often get a further discount by insuring both or all under a multi-bike policy.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Extra savings&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;br&gt;
Meanwhile there are a variety of bonus options that can come free. For example, Bikesure offers legal cover at no extra cost, and can often cover European touring jaunts at no extra cost as well - sometimes for as much as 90 days at a time.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Another way of reducing overall costs is to add breakdown insurance to the policy, instead of joining one of the big national breakdown organisations. For instance, Bikesure's breakdown cover, which includes homestart and roadside assistance, is only &amp;pound;52 for one bike and &amp;pound;10 per additional bike on a multi-bike policy.&lt;/p&gt;

<title>Bikesure warns of rise in pothole-related accidents</title>
<description>&lt;p&gt;
&lt;img src=&quot;&lt;%PATH_IMAGE%&gt;news/posts/263-1.jpg&quot; align=&quot;right&quot; class=&quot;news&quot; /&gt;
As bikers bring their motorcycles out of winter hibernation, specialist insurance broker &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.bikesure.co.uk/&quot;&gt;Bikesure&lt;/a&gt; is issuing a stark warning about potholes.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;&amp;quot;Even before the biking season really gets off the ground, we've seen a rise in pothole-related claims,&amp;quot; says Kevin Lee of Bikesure. &amp;quot;Luckily so far we've had none with serious injuries, but it's a real possibility. A pothole can swallow a front wheel and throw a rider off instantly. We urge bikers to be very, very aware of the danger.&amp;quot;&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;The winter weather that caused the potholes is clearing away, but the potholes themselves look like being here for a while, especially on some rural roads. Organisers of Spring biking tours throughout the country should take special care, suggests Kevin.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;Bikesure offers these pothole awareness tips:&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;ul&gt;
 &lt;li&gt;Puddles: don't assume they're benign, they could be rain-filled potholes hiding a nasty surprise.&lt;/li&gt;
 &lt;li&gt;On the edge: be aware that many potholes are created at the borders or edges of roads, where they can be disguised by plants, mud or debris.&lt;/li&gt;
 &lt;li&gt;Stay back: allow more space than usual behind the vehicle in front - it will give time to spot and avoid any potholes that cars or lorries simply drive over.&lt;/li&gt;
 &lt;li&gt;Slow down: riders who are not sure of the state of the road surface should take it more slowly than usual.&lt;/li&gt;
 &lt;li&gt;Get out of the rut: if the road a biker usually uses is full of potholes, find a different route.&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;/ul&gt;

<title>Bikesure Makes PL Even Sweeter For Motorcycle Clubs</title>
<description>&lt;p&gt;
&lt;img src=&quot;&lt;%PATH_IMAGE%&gt;news/posts/233-1.jpg&quot; align=&quot;right&quot; class=&quot;news&quot; /&gt;
Motorcycle clubs need public liability insurance if they take part in public shows and events. It was a prohibitive expense for many clubs, until Bikesure launched its club public liability (PL) scheme earlier this year. It cut the cost to as little as &amp;pound;110 per year and has been very popular - so much so that Bikesure is now expanding it to cover 'business all risk'.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;This means that as well as cover for public liability, the insurance protects the club's possessions at a show, ranging from merchandise such as T-shirts to stands, graphics and flags.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;And the best news is, Bikesure PL still costs from as little as &amp;pound;110 per year, for up to &amp;pound;1million public liability cover and &amp;pound;2,500-worth of club assets.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.bikesure.co.uk/&quot; target=&quot;_blank&quot;&gt;Bikesure&lt;/a&gt; has a special team that looks after clubs and develops schemes for them. &amp;quot;Lots of our clubs take stands, graphics and club merchandise to shows,&amp;quot; says Rob Balls of Bikesure. &amp;quot;Together they can add up to a lot of value but often they're not insured, so it made sense to expand Bikesure PL. It covers these assets against accidental loss or damage in just about any eventuality, from storms and floods to fire or falling trees. It also covers theft, other than from unattended motor vehicles.&amp;quot;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Bikesure PL is available 'off the shelf' and is designed mainly for clubs who attend up to twelve events per year. For clubs that attend more events, or who require higher levels of public liability or asset cover, the Bikesure club team can prepare a tailored policy that should still be cheaper than a traditional scheme. It's cheaper because Bikesure has got rid of the PL elements that clubs don't need, such as libel and slander insurance.&lt;/p&gt;
